The African Methodist Episcopal Hymn and Tune Book: adapted to the doctrines and usages of the church (6th ed.)

Publisher: A.M.E. Book Concern, Philadelphia, 1902
Denomination: African Methodist Episcopal Church
Language: English
Notes: Numbering follows the hymnal numbering except where there are two tunes for a text or a separate doxology tune added, in which cases the editor has added "a" and "b" to the numbers.
